#2bb356 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2bb356 is composed of 16.9% red, 70.2%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 76% cyan, 0% magenta, 52% yellow and 29.8% black. It has a hue angle of 139 degrees, a saturation of 61.3% and a lightness of 43.5%. #2bb356 color hex could be obtained by blending #56ffac with #006700.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

#2bb356 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2bb356 has RGB values of R:43, G:179, B:86 and CMYK values of C:0.76, M:0, Y:0.52, K:0.3. Its decimal value is 2863958.
